
Cudy M1300 AC1200 Whole Home Mesh WiFi System (3-Pack)
A budget-friendly mesh system delivering reliable AC1200 speeds for whole-home coverage in small to medium spaces.
Cudy isn’t a household name yet, but the M1300 mesh system makes a strong case for why it should be. Each of the three nodes packs two Gigabit Ethernet ports, which is rare at this price point. That means you can wire a desktop, gaming console, or smart TV directly into any satellite for a stable 1 Gbps wired backhaul. The system covers most homes up to 5,000 square feet without dead zones, and beamforming helps focus the signal toward connected devices rather than broadcasting blindly.
In daily use, the AC1200 speeds feel responsive. You get up to 300 Mbps on 2.4 GHz and 867 Mbps on 5 GHz, which handles 4K streaming, video calls, and online gaming simultaneously across a dozen devices. Roaming is seamless—your phone or laptop switches between nodes without dropping the connection. The Cudy app includes parental controls and basic QoS for prioritizing bandwidth, though the interface is functional rather than polished. Setup takes about ten minutes through the app, and the system supports access point mode if you already have a router.
One honest limitation: the M1300 lacks Wi-Fi 6, so if you have a fleet of newer devices, you won’t get the latest efficiency gains. But for most households still on Wi-Fi 5 gear, this three-pack delivers reliable, whole-home coverage at a price that undercuts more established names. The wired ports alone make it a smart choice for anyone with devices that benefit from a hardline connection.
